Importers move SHC against levy of RD on import of steel products

KARACHI: The Sindh High Court (SHC) issued notices to the customs department and deputy attorney general on a petition filed by M/s AKK Enterprises, M/s Steel Craft Pvt Ltd and M/s Perfect Craft (SMC-Pvt) Ltd against the regulatory duty on import of steel products.

During the hearing, a two-member bench, headed by Justice Aqeel Ahmed Abbasi on September 17, 2018 directed them to file their para-wise comments on next date of hearing.

During the hearing, counsel for the importers stated that the petitioners are aggrieved by the action of the respondents, who enhanced the valuation of steel products on the basis of Valuation Ruling No 1035/ 2017, which was declared as illegal and arbitrary by the SHC on various constitutional petitions, however, customs officials are still demanding regulatory duty on the said goods.

Citing Secretary Ministry of Finance, Collector of Customs Appraisement East, West and Port Muhammad Bin Qasim and others as respondents, he pleaded the court to declare that act of the respondents as illegal, mala fide. He also pleaded the court to restrain them from taking any coercive action against the importers till final order in this petition.
